Samsung Galaxy A26 5G vs Motorola Edge 70 Fusion Plus

Compared 2 smartphones : Samsung Galaxy A26 5G Manufactured in March, 2025, with display 6.7 with chipsetSamsung Exynos 1380, vs Motorola Edge 70 Fusion Plus, Manufactured in March, 2026with chipsetQualcomm Snapdragon 7s Gen 4. Below are specs, tests, pros and cons for each device

Key Differences

Device key advantages
Reasons to choose Samsung Galaxy A26 5G
  • Lighter design: 164g vs 177g
Reasons to choose Motorola Edge 70 Fusion Plus
  • Larger display: 6.8in
  • Higher pixel density: 449ppi
  • Higher refresh rate: 144Hz
  • Higher battery capacity: 5200mAh vs 5000mAh
  • Newer Bluetooth version: 6.0 vs 5.3
  • Built-in eSIM
